Tips to Hire Translations Company

Hiring a 1globaltranslators translation agency is an necessary decision that can considerably impact the quality and effectiveness of your converted content. Here are some tips to help you find and select a good translation agency:

State Your Needs and Plans: Clearly outline a person's translation requirements, aim for languages, and the function of the translations. Different kinds of content might require various levels of expertise or specialization.

Research and additionally Shortlist: Look for highly regarded translation agencies internet, ask for recommendations coming from colleagues or business peers, and generate a shortlist of likely agencies.

Check Credentials and Experience:

Examine the agency's references, such as certifications, affiliations with professional interpretation associations, and industry recognition.
Evaluate the agency's experience in your certain industry or domain. Experience in your area of interest can lead to more accurate and contextually correct translations.
Assess Good quality Assurance Processes:

Ask about the agency's excellent control procedures, including how they ensure consistency, consistency, and ethnic appropriateness.
Ask assuming they use native sound systems for translation along with review, as this may significantly improve the quality of the translations.
Review Sample Work:

Require sample translations and case studies in connection with your industry. This can give you an idea with the agency's work good quality and style.
Solutions and Tools:

1globaltranslators Consult about the translation tools and technologies they use. Translation reminiscence systems and glossaries can enhance reliability across projects.
Secrecy and Data Protection:

Ensure the company has strict confidentiality policies in place, particularly your content contains private information.
Project Supervision and Communication:

Measure the agency's project management process. Efficient communication and timely upgrades are crucial for a gentle translation process.
Charge and Pricing System:

Obtain detailed the prices information upfront. A few agencies charge per word, while others might have more complex pricing set ups.
Get Multiple Estimates:

Request quotes on a few shortlisted institutions. While cost is extremely important, prioritize quality along with expertise over the least costly option.
Check Feedback and Testimonials:

Seek out online reviews and additionally testimonials from past clients to get a preview of their experiences with the agency.
Ask Problems:

Don't hesitate to ask that agency about your workflow, turnaround circumstances, and how they work with revisions and responses.
Contracts and Documents:

Make sure to have a crystal clear contract that collections the scope of work, deadlines, money terms, and any other important terms.
Scalability:

If you foresee looking for translations regularly or simply in larger quantities of prints, consider an agency together with the capacity to scale their services in order to satisfy your needs.
Gut Sensation:

Trust your intuition after interacting with your agency. A positive rapport and transparent transmission are valuable signs and symptoms of a good working relationship.
Remember that selecting the right translation agency involves more than just how to find the lowest price. Prioritize quality, accuracy, in addition to cultural sensitivity to ensure your translated subject material effectively communicates ones own message to your customers.
